How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 75032?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
75032 Studio Apartments | $1,519 | $1,238 | $2,694 |
75032 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,822 | $1,105 | $5,474 |
75032 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,305 | $1,099 | $8,599 |
75032 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,894 | $1,225 | $8,468 |
75032 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,010 | $2,215 | $6,810 |
